Transaction 3c7f43d7e5d67c129f32acfde64b824397481eac3a9196fba5b9f2d0eaf70ca4
1 Input
1 Output
-
3c7f43d7e5d67c129f32acfde64b824397481eac3a9196fba5b9f2d0eaf70ca4:0
- value
- 23754527
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 942e8261445d088202eb1da43d49d67a098fddb3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EWWiuyyQFdGX2R6jGFQ7pAfn6gC8bXfqJ